Packaging Issues in Dried & Powdered Foods
Even though these foods do not have much water, they are extremely sensitive to environments. The following are what affect their quality:
| Spoilage Factor | Effect on Product |
|---|---|
| Oxygen | Oxidation, rancidness, loss of flavor |
| Moisture | Clumping, bacterial growth |
| Microorganisms | Spoilage, health hazard |
| Loss of Aroma | Reduced consumer attractiveness |
Packaging has to be airtight, dry, and free of oxygen to prevent spoilage.
What is Nitrogen Flushing in Food Packaging?
Nitrogen flushing is one type of modified atmosphere packaging (MAP) that involves the replacement of oxygen in the package with nitrogen gas before closure. As nitrogen is inert as well as dry, it slows down the sensitive food item without having any flavor, aroma, or texture impact.
It is widely applied for snack food, coffee, spice, protein powder, and pharmaceutical packaging to extend shelf life and render the product safe.

Why Use a PSA Nitrogen Generator?
A PSA Nitrogen Generator (Pressure Swing Adsorption) allows food companies to generate nitrogen in-house from air. It's a green, cost-saving, and eco-friendly alternative that minimizes the use of nitrogen gas cylinders.
